#24261d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#24261d is composed of 14.1% red, 14.9%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.7% yellow and 85.1% black. It has a hue angle of 73.3 degrees, a saturation of 13.4% and a lightness of 13.1%. #24261d color hex could be obtained by blending #484c3a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#24261d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040504 is the darkest color, while #fafaf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#24261d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#232320 is the less saturated color, while #344201 is the most saturated one.
